ObjectiveTo investigate relationship between high-sensitivity C-reactive protein (hs-CRP), serum uric acid (SUA), lipoprotein-associated phospholipase A2 (LpPLA2) and cardiovascular event in essential hypertension patients.MethodsAmong a total of 216 patients with essential hypertension, 112 cases of them with cardiovascular event were taken as observation group, and the other 104 cases without cardiovascular event as control group. Their contents of hs-CRP, SUA, and LpPLA2 in peripheral blood were detected.ResultsThe observation group had much higher contents of hs-CRP, SUA, and LpPLA2 than the control group (P<0.01). Contents of hs-CRP, SUA, and LpPLA2 in the observation group were related with criticality of cardiovascular event. The higher contents would lead to higher criticality of cardiovascular event. The myocardial infarction group had obviously higher contents of hs-CRP, SUA, and LpPLA2 than the stenocardia group (P<0.01).
